I know as a fact that the cpu always works (kept busy), i.e. even when you see "system idle process" in the task manager, that doesn't mean the cpu actually idles, but it means that the OS is sending it some dummy process to do while there's nothing else to do.
Given that, why is my cpu temp at say 29c when idle, but 38c under full load, when in fact its been under full load the whole time?
A possible explanation could be that cpu Mhz, or power consumption can be reduced while working on idle process, but I'm not sure.
